Novices Guide to Metal Polishing - More often than not, the finishing of metal is necessary for aesthetic reasons and for clean-room situations. It is one of the more preferred solutions because of its usefulness in intensifying the overall beauty of the product, for instance, motorcycle parts, cookware or car parts. Also, a great many clean-rooms would need a sleek finish so to reduce the porosity of the material that can result in particles to gather and contaminate. A superb instance of this application might be in vacuum chambers.

You'll find a great many methods of finish metals, and let us have a look at several of the methods involved. Metal can be finished chemically, electromechanically, using purpose built buffing machines, or simply by hand. A polishing paste or compound is frequently utilised, which may contain aluminum oxide, tripoli, limestone, chalk, chromium oxide, dolomite, or iron oxide.

Polishing stainless steel, because of its low thermal conductivity, its hardness, and its fairly high viscidness is amongst the time intensive. On the flip side, products built from non-ferrous metal tend to be responsive to polishing, as these call for the lowest number of treatments.

A lesser pad speed is commonly employed any time a premium quality mirror finish is vital. Finishing buffs daubed with paste will be seriously impacted by specific pressures on the surface of the pad. The level of the surface pressure may be amplified to a chosen level, having said that, further surpassing the optimal amount of load not just decreases the quality level of treatment, but additionally can degrade performance, may cause wear to the part, and there's additionally an evident overheating of the items being worked on, because of friction. When you are using thinner pieces, it will be higher heat (and a resultant flexibility of the material) which can cause items to warp, distort, or bend. In general, it takes a talented technician to factor in all of these variables to both not cause harm to the workpiece and to perform the project correctly. In order to radically boost the quality of the resultant surface, the buffing process needs to be performed with a lesser amount of power and not so much pressure in an effort to eventually deliver a surface area that doesn't have any scores or fine lines brought about by the finishing procedure, thus ending up with a fabulous mirror finish.
